Like most stick insects this species is docile by nature. It is nocturnal and will generally only move during the night. It has an amazing defense strategy: it will mimic a scorpion when threatened. If they are disturbed, they will curl up their tail to mimic a scorpion. Sometimes they will even raise their front legs to mimic … See more This species of stick insect looks more like a cactus than like a twig. Its body is bulky and covered in small spines. On its legs it has big lobes that are also spiked and look like leaves of a … See more Extatosoma tiaratum eat the leaves of blackberry, raspberry, oak, rose, hazel and eucalyptus. In the winter you can still find fresh blackberry leaves outside. Beware of leaves from the store, which are sprayed with insecticide! … See more Males and females are easily distinguishable. Adult females are big, heavy and do not have large wings. The males are long and … See more You can keep these stick insects at a temperature between 20 ° C and 30 ° C. Instead of burying them in the soil or dropping them on the floor, they catapult their ova out of the … WebFeb 1, 2024 · The giant prickly stick insect is native to Australia and New Guinea. Because of its thorny looking body, it is often mistaken for a cactus plant rather than a stick or a twig. It can vary in colour, and although typically light to mid-brown, it can be dark brown, beige, or even green. The colour will usually depend on its surroundings. WebGiant Prickly Stick Insect This formidable stick insect can grow up to 8 inches long and is covered with giant spikes that look like thorns, hence the descriptive name. WebOct 8, 2024 · Giant Prickly Stick Insects can live at room temperature, so you won’t need to micromanage the temperature in the enclosure. Usually, a temperature between 68-86 °F is more than enough for them to thrive. During the night, you can even drop the temperature to a safe level of 59 °F. If it’s too cold, you’ll need a heater like a light bulb.

You will mostly … WebGiant prickly stick insects get their name since their body structure mimics a stick. Females are covered with thorn-like spikes for defense and camouflage. Females can grow to 5-8 inches in length. Male giant prickly stick insects are much smaller and thinner, they grow in length from 3-4 inches. Males lack thorny growth except around their eyes.
